Czy algorytmy mogą rozwiązać wszystkie problemy?

Spisu treści:

Czy algorytmy mogą rozwiązać wszystkie problemy?
Czy algorytmy mogą rozwiązać wszystkie problemy?
Anonim

Cóż, algorytm to sekwencja kroków, która rozwiązuje problem. Zgodnie z tą definicją (a właściwie większością definicji algorytmu) każdy program komputerowy jest również algorytmem. Każdy problem Eulera można rozwiązać za pomocą programu komputerowego, więc odpowiedź brzmi tak.

Których problemów nie rozwiązuje żaden algorytm?

Wyjaśnienie: problemy nie mogą być rozwiązane przez żaden algorytm są nazywane problemami nierozstrzygalnymi. problemy, które można rozwiązać w czasie wielomianowym, nazywane są problemami wykonalnymi.

Czy każdy problem można rozwiązać?

Zawsze istnieje rozwiązanie

Możesz w to nie wierzyć, ale każdy problem można rozwiązać. Oczywiście logiczne, matematyczne lub poznawcze problemy zawsze będą miały poprawną odpowiedź, ale co z tymi nielogicznymi, nieliniowymi problemami?

Czy wiele algorytmów może rozwiązać problemy?

Pamiętaj, nie ma jednej właściwej odpowiedzi .� Dla każdego problemu można zaakceptować wiele różnych algorytmów. � Ze względu na elastyczność języka angielskiego ten sam algorytm można często wyrazić na więcej niż jeden sposób. � Ponadto prawie zawsze istnieje więcej niż jeden sposób rozwiązania problemu.

Jakie jest 5 właściwości algorytmu?

Algorytm musi mieć pięć właściwości:

  • Określono dane wejściowe.
  • Wybrano wyjście.
  • Określenie.
  • Skuteczność.
  • Skończoność.

Zalecana: